Alerus Financial Corporation (Nasdaq: ALRS) reported a net income of $8.2 million or $0.40 per diluted share for Q1 2023, down from $10.9 million or $0.53 per share in Q4 2022. This marks a decline from $10.2 million or $0.57 in Q1 2022. The company experienced margin pressures and challenges in the mortgage sector, affecting profitability. CEO Katie Lorenson noted that over 50% of total revenues came from fee income, emphasizing a well-diversified business model. The common equity tier 1 capital ratio was at 13.3%, with total deposits rising by 4.0% to $3.0 billion, while the net interest margin fell to 2.70%. Noninterest income decreased by 1.0% from the previous quarter, primarily due to lower mortgage banking revenues as originations fell by 58.4% due to high interest rates.

Alerus Financial Corporation (NASDAQ: ALRS) announced a $0.18 quarterly cash dividend, marking a 12.5% increase from the previous year. The dividend is payable on April 14, 2023, to shareholders on record as of March 15, 2023. Alerus Financial Corporation (Nasdaq: ALRS) reported a net income of $10.9 million for Q4 2022, translating to $0.53 per diluted share, up from $9.6 million in Q3 2022. The company experienced a 24.1% decline in full-year net income, totaling $40.0 million, compared to $52.7 million in 2021. Notably, a significant acquisition of Metro Phoenix Bank led to a 39.0% increase in loans. The efficiency ratio improved to 69.6% from 74.8% in Q3 2022, while noninterest expenses decreased 11.3%. Despite challenges, Alerus declared an 11% increase in dividends, reflecting ongoing commitment to shareholder returns.
